The SEAOHUN Foundation (based in Chiang Mai) Vacancy Positions (closed)

Established in 2011, the South East Asia One Health University Network (SEAOHUN) is a consortium of universities and faculties in Indonesia, Malaysia, Thailand and Vietnam that are collaborating to build capacity and academic partnerships with government, national, and regional stakeholders to respond to outbreaks of emerging infectious diseases in the South East Asia region, adopting the One Health approach. The Foundation has responsibility to the SEAOHUN Executive Board for the operations and management of the South East Asia regional office in Chiang Mai.


The Program Manager is a senior-level professional who is expected to exercise a leadership role in planning, implementation and evaluation of the regional activities of SEAOHUN and to manage its relationship with affiliated One Health Networks in the four countries.
The Finance Officer will manage all financial transactions related to the SEAOHUN Regional Operations.
The Administrative Officer assists the Program Manager and provides support in all aspects of administration, logistics, procurement, and human resources.
